* [PATCH] drm/imagination: Reasoning code comments for Sparse warnings/errors
@ 2025-06-06 15:04 Alexandru Dadu
0 siblings, 0 replies; only message in thread
From: Alexandru Dadu @ 2025-06-06 15:04 UTC (permalink / raw)
To: Frank Binns, Matt Coster, Maarten Lankhorst, Maxime Ripard,
Thomas Zimmermann, David Airlie, Simona Vetter
Cc: dri-devel, linux-kernel, Alexandru Dadu
Added code comments for the lines that might generate Sparse
warnings/errors.
The warnings/errors cannot be fixed with refactoring without masively
impacting the whole code implementation and/or they are incorrectly
generated by Sparse.

+/*
+ ******************************************************************************
+ * SPARSE warning reasoning: SIZE_CHECK(struct rogue_fwif_frag_ctx_state, 16)
+ ******************************************************************************
+ *
+ * The structure rogue_fwif_frag_ctx_state contains a flexible size field.
+ * The SIZE_CHECK will run a static_assert function over the structure and it
+ * will use 'sizeof' over a flexible structure.
+ * The implementation of the flexible size field is there by design and cannot
+ * be refactored in a way thet doesn't impact key features.
+ * To avoid having the sparse warning this argument can be used when triggering
+ * the sparse check from the build command "-Wno-sizeof-array-argument"
+ */

+/*
+ ******************************************************************************
+ * SPARSE error reasoning: SIZE_CHECK(struct rogue_fwif_hwrtdata, 384)
+ ******************************************************************************
+ *
+ * The structure rogue_fwif_hwrtdata contains different memory alignment
+ * attributes for its fields.
+ * The SIZE_CHECK will run a static_assert function over the structure to check
+ * the size. The compilation will fail if the SIZE_CHECK fails.
+ * SPARSE seems to treat the alignment attributes in a different way than the
+ * compilation does since the compilation is not failing.
+ * This SPARSE error over this line should be ignored if it pops up.
+ */
